**Vendor note: Inkmill markdown pipeline**

Rendering for Parchway docs is outsourced to Inkmill under an annual contract, renewing each March. They handle sanitization and PDF export; we own the upload queue. SLA: 4-hour response on rendering failures. Escalate only after two failed retries. Their support desk is reachable at the address below.

billing contact of hahaf-baguf = zorael.tammir.jorius@sivrelhq.internal

## Step 6: Invalidate the Pellgrove catalog cache

After the new catalog build is live, trigger invalidation carefully: first warm the standby cache tier, then publish the invalidation event to the catalog topic. Do not skip the warm-up — cold misses against the pricing service have caused timeouts before. Confirm hit rates recover above 92% within ten minutes before proceeding. The invalidation event must be signed or edge consumers will silently drop it; sign it with the key below.

release key, bawef-yagap: bky9_B5txx7RXt

Password Reset Flow Revamp — Review Notes

The revamped flow in Fernwick Auth replaces emailed tokens with short-lived signed links. Token table `reset_grants` is now append-only; cleanup runs hourly via the Mossline scheduler. Verify the migration backfills `expires_at` for legacy rows before approving. To inspect the staging data, connect with the string below.

primary connection of yagep-kahip = redis://giliel_svc:zYiKsLL2PLpfPL@db-348f.xolmarsys.corp:5432/fenwyn